Street Fighter 6 is currently slated for a June 2, 2023 release date. Thankfully, Street Fighter 6 has managed to narrowly avoid the juggernaut that is The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om, which is guaranteed to be the talk of the industry in May, just as Breath of the Wild was in 2017. But in escaping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om, Street Fighter 6 has left itself vulnerable to an attack on two fronts, with both Final Fantasy 16 and Diablo 4 also releasing in June.

Just a few days after Street Fighter 6 releases, Diablo 4 releases on June 6, 2023. A sequel that's been in the works for at least three years, Diablo 4 is one of the most anticipated games of the year, and its recent Beta has only cemented fans' excitement even further. But Diablo 4 isn't the only fantasy RPG releasing in June, with its own heavy competition coming on June 22, 2023 in the form of Final Fantasy 16.

Thankfully, Street Fighter 6 might be able to slide under the radar in a good way. Though its audiences are quite different, and some fans might intend to pick up both games, Diablo 4 and Final Fantasy 16 both offer expansive fantasy RPG experiences which presumably require a great deal of time from the player. While these two giants of the industry battle it out, Street Fighter 6 has its own special niche to offer its fans, that being the first big fighting title of the year.

It's been quite some time since the last Street Fighter game, and fan expectations are high. It also seems according to the trailers that Street Fighter 6 is trying to target a wider audience than ever before, with a new control scheme, new art style, and a slew of extra features designed to help newcomers to the franchise, and newcomers to the fighting genre as a whole. If Street Fighter 6 manages to pull off its highly ambitious premise and bring in both old fans and new, then it doesn't really need to worry about the rest of the games releasing in June as its fighting game gameplay sets it completely apart from the other big two titles dropping that month. Still, that might be a tall order.
